What is Home Energy Scotland?
Home Energy Scotland (HES) is the Scottish Government's flagship grant and loan scheme for energy efficiency improvements. It is delivered free of charge by Energy Saving Trust on behalf of Scottish Ministers.
Unlike English schemes, HES combines a cashback grant with an interest-free loan, meaning most homeowners can fund a complete retrofit without taking on commercial debt.

How much can you get in 2026?
The headline figures: up to £7,500 grant per qualifying measure, plus an interest-free loan of up to £7,500 to top up the cost. Rural and island households can access an additional £1,500 uplift, taking total support up to £18,000.
Heat pumps, solar PV, insulation and energy storage all qualify. Multiple measures can be combined under a single application.

Who qualifies?
You must own and live in the property, or be in the process of purchasing it. The home must be in Scotland and have a valid EPC. There is no income cap — HES is available to all Scottish homeowners.

How to apply
Step 1: Call HES on 0808 808 2282 for a free, impartial advice call. Step 2: Receive a tailored Home Energy Report. Step 3: Get installer quotes from MCS-certified firms. Step 4: Submit your funding application before work begins.
Approval takes 4–8 weeks. Funds are paid on completion against installer invoices.

Avoid grant scams
Home Energy Scotland never cold-calls, texts or door-knocks. The only legitimate route is to contact HES directly on 0808 808 2282 or via homeenergyscotland.co.uk.
Always verify your installer is MCS-certified (mcscertified.com) for heat pumps and renewables, or TrustMark-registered (trustmark.org.uk) for insulation and other works. Report scams to Advice Direct Scotland on 0808 164 6000.

Frequently asked questions
Do I have to repay the grant portion?+
No. The grant is cashback that does not need to be repaid. Only the loan top-up is repayable, and it is interest-free over up to 12 years.
Can I apply if I've already started work?+
No. Applications must be approved before installation begins. Retrospective applications are rejected.
